I still have yet to see another G8x on the road besides mine, but I do follow the market around here and the cars are selling. Whether to local buyers or folks out of town I don’t know, but pace is picking up. When the cars first landed some sat on the lot for a month or longer, but now all appear to be moving within days. It’s difficult to tell just what is actually happening as everything is selling now, they can’t keep any desirable new cars in stock at the BMW places I speak with.

The sales success of the vehicles likely won’t be known for a couple of years until the market/chips stabilize AND we see about the LCI updates on the G82. If the grills suddenly shrink in a few years, there’s the answer.
